can a msfc card router traffic between different networks or only to different vlan>?
 
I guess I'd consider a different vlan the same thing as a different network. Unless I'm not understanding your question correctly.
 
im talking about having more than one vlan on a switch i know that the mfc card can route packet to the other vlans but what about other network outside the firewall?
 
You can treat it just like any other router. All just depends on how you want it to route. Via Static, ospf, eigrp, etc.
 
Thanks.. ok so is the mfc card located in the supervisor or is it separate?
 
It depends on what Supervisor engine you have... Is it a SUP-1A, SUP-2, or the SUP-720?

Log into the switch and do the following:

xxxxxxxxx#show modu
xxxxxxxxx#show module
Mod Ports Card Type Model Serial No.
--- ----- -------------------------------------- ------------------ -----------
1 2 Catalyst 6000 supervisor 2 (Active) WS-X6K-S2U-MSFC2 Sxxxxxxxxx
2 2 Catalyst 6000 supervisor 2 (Warm) WS-X6K-S2U-MSFC2 Sxxxxxxxxx
